General Information

  • Title: Geophysical log signatures of Lower Tertiary and Upper Cretaceous rocks in the Powder River Basin, Wyoming and Montana
  • Author(s): Seeland, David, Hardie, J.K., Gibbons, A.B., Johnson, E.A., Biewick, L.R.H., McLellan, M.W., Molina, C.L., and Pierce, F.W.
  • Publishing Organization: U.S. Geological Survey
  • Series and Number: Oil and Gas Investigations Chart OC-140
  • Publication Date: 1993
  • Map Scale: 1:7,000,000
  • Cross Section: Yes
  • North Latitude: 46° 5' 0" N (46.0833)
  • South Latitude: 42° 42' 0" N (42.7000)
  • East Longitude: 104° 5' 0" W (-104.0833)
  • West Longitude: 107° 12' 30" W (-107.2083)
